‘EXPANDING THE QUALITY ‘SPIRIT’ OF VET (Q&VET)’ 4TH
TRANSNATIONAL MEETING WAS HELD ON
THE 2ND-3RD OF JUNE 2014 IN MAASTRICHT, THE NETHERLANDS
‘Expanding the quality ‘spirit’ of VET (Q&VET)’ 4th transnational meeting was held on the 2nd-3rd
of June 2014 in Maastricht, the Netherlands. The meeting intended to scrupulously discuss the
draft guidelines, which are the main goal of the project.
The partners from Austria, Belarus, Italy, Netherlands, Russia,
Sweden, and Turkey attended the meeting. The first matter to cover
was the Interim evaluation report from EACEA. It was followed by a
plenary session on the draft guidelines. Internal monitoring,
dissemination and finances were deliberated on during the second
day of the meeting.

‘Expanding the quality ‘spirit’ of VET is a Leonardo Da Vinci project, launched on the 1st
of November
2012. Its goal is developing a set of guidelines which enable and support the leadership in a VET-
provider organisation to motivate and engage teaching staff in quality assurance initiatives.
